Therapeutic Yoga

​

My root teacher B.K.S. Iyengar believed that everybody, no matter what age or condition, could benefit from practicing Yoga. He understood that the body has its own integrity and through injury or bad habits this integrity gets disturbed and then creates symptoms. We need a balance of strength and flexibility and freedom. The joints do have a balanced, healthy body. Luckily in doing the dissection of a human body in my original courses as an Occupational Therapist helped me to understand his approach. My work with students who have chronic problems can be as simple as physical poses or as deep as self-inquiry. 

​

In a 2010 interview with Iyengar Association of the North West,   I said all Iyengar Yoga is therapeutic. I call it Therapeutic Yoga when there is a major or long standing physical difficulty. This is when particular modifications need to be taught in a one-to-one setting. It is individualize instruction intended  to recreate the integrity of that joint or muscle.
